Fifth Shipment of Talgo Train for Uzbekistan via St. Petersburg

  • Sea Port of Saint-Petersburg and Universal Forwarder have unloaded a high-speed Talgo passenger train for Uzbek Railways.

    The Talgo-250 train consists of two 67-ton locomotives and 15 railcars weighing between 14.6 and 18.3 tons depending on the type.

    The train arrived to the port of St. Petersburg from Bilbao, Spain, on board the “Finnbreze” ro-ro vessel. From the port, it will travel almost 5 thousand kilometers to Uzbekistan by rail.

    The train will be deployed transporting passengers on the Tashkent – Bukhara – Khiva route.

    Sea Port of Saint-Petersburg and Universal Forwarder have been participating in the international project to deliver Talgo trains to Uzbekistan for 10 year already. This was the fifth shipment, the next one is expected to arrive in September.
